Redis在Windows 10上的启动问题解决指南

Redis是一款广受欢迎的内存数据库,适用于很多高性能需求的场景。然而,在Windows 10上运行Redis时,有时会出现启动没反应的问题。下面,我们将通过一系列步骤教会你如何解决这个问题。

整体流程概览

首先,我们可以将整体流程整理为以下的步骤:

步骤 描述
1 下载Redis
2 解压Redis
3 启动Redis服务器
4 验证Redis是否正常工作

我们同样可以使用mermaid语法将这个流程表示为流程图:

flowchart TD
    A[下载Redis] --> B[解压Redis]
    B --> C[启动Redis服务器]
    C --> D[验证是否正常工作]

详细步骤解析

1. 下载Redis

  • 前往 [Redis for Windows]( 页面,下载最新版的Redis压缩包。选择 .zip 后缀的版本。

2. 解压Redis

  • 将下载的压缩包解压到你想要的目录,比如 C:\Redis。确保解压后的路径包含 redis-server.exe 文件。

3. 启动Redis服务器

  • 打开命令提示符(CMD),并导航到Redis的解压目录。使用以下命令启动Redis服务器:
cd C:\Redis
redis-server.exe redis.windows.conf
  • 这里,cd C:\Redis 是将命令行切换到Redis所在的文件夹,而 redis-server.exe redis.windows.conf 则是启动Redis服务器并指定配置文件。

4. 验证Redis是否正常工作

  • 在另一个命令提示符窗口中,输入以下命令,连接到Redis服务器:
cd C:\Redis
redis-cli.exe
  • 如果连接成功,你应该会看到提示符变化,输入 ping 命令,验证是否正常工作:
ping
  • 如果返回 PONG,则表示Redis服务器已成功启动并正常运行。

甘特图调度展示

接下来,我们使用mermaid语法生成一个甘特图,以便我们可以直观地了解整个过程的时间安排:

gantt
    title Redis启动流程
    dateFormat  YYYY-MM-DD
    section 下载Redis
    下载Redis         :a1, 2023-10-01, 1d
    section 解压Redis
    解压文件          :a2, after a1, 1d
    section 启动Redis
    启动服务器        :a3, after a2, 1d
    section 验证
    验证Redis          :a4, after a3, 1d

结论

通过本教程,我们详细讲解了在Windows 10上如何下载、解压和启动Redis。如果在启动过程中遇到问题,可以检查防火墙设置,确保端口6379没有被封锁。此外,确保运行时使用的命令无误,这对于避免启动失败尤为重要。

希望这份指南能够帮助你顺利启动Redis,并为你今后的开发工作提供便利!如果有任何疑问或其他问题,随时欢迎向我咨询!